## Releases

Hey support folks — quick notes on ProfileMesh shard releases. Each release re-balances user-profile shards gradually, so don't panic if a lookup lands on a stale shard for a few minutes post-deploy; it self-heals. Release bundles are published twice a month and are always signed. If a customer asks you to verify a bundle they downloaded, walk them through the checksum step using the public signing key below.

deploy key for kawif-bageg: bky19_YQNdHDgpaLxUNwPoHm9

Capacity note: the Harwick Public Library catalogue import kicks off nightly and it's a beast — roughly 2M MARC records through the Shelfwright pipeline. If the ingest workers start swapping, don't panic; bump the batch size down before adding nodes. Memory headroom matters more than CPU here. The current tuning constants we're running in prod are listed below.

tuning table, fawip-fahag:
WEIGHTS = {
    "novwyn": 452,
    "casdor": 675,
}

## Grindstone — Environments

Grindstone replaces the homegrown job queue (Cartwheel) and runs in three environments: dev, staging, prod. Dev uses an in-memory broker; staging and prod use the shared Hollowmere cluster. Cartwheel compatibility shims are enabled only in staging until the Q3 cutover. Review note: config diffs between environments must go through the usual approval flow — no direct edits. Staging mirrors prod settings except for worker counts. For reference during review, the staging configuration values are as follows.

deployment values, tafog-kagap:
wenath:
  pin: 4244
  metrics_host: metrics.wenath.lumicsys.internal
  tenant: istix
  seal: seal_10585894

TURN-208: Gatevale turnstile counters at the Merrow Field pilot double-count when a rotation reverses mid-cycle. Attendance totals drift roughly 2% high per event. The debounce window fix is implemented, reviewed by Ilsa, and soak-tested across two simulated match days without drift. Ready for your cut; the candidate build is identified below.

trace token, tagag-tafog: htk6_5ed18c